William Elmer “Bill” Mabe, of Heppner died, Saturday, February 20, 2021 at Kadlec Reginal Medical Center in Richland, Washington. He was born on June 25, 1955, in Heppner, the son of Harold and Ruby Mabe. He spent his growing up years in Fossil, graduation from Wheeler Co. High School in 1973.
Bill worked on ranches a big share of his life, before working at Walmart Distribution Center in Hermiston. At the time of his death, he was working for Morrow County Grain Growers in Lexington.
He loved spending time with family, camping, hunting, and fishing.
Survivors include his loving companion, Linda Harper, a brother Marvin Mabe, a sister Mildred Nelson and a host of nieces and nephews.
Bill was preceded in death by his parents, Harold and Ruby, brothers, Harold Dean, Rod and a sister Shirley.
